Declaration of RoHS Compliance
This product has been designed and manufactured in compliance with Directive 
2011/65/EU of the European Parliament and the Council on restriction of the use 
of certain hazardous substances in electrical and electronic equipment (RoHS 
Directive) and is deemed to comply with the maximum concentration values issued 
by the European Technical Adaptation Committee (TAC) as shown below:
Substance 
Proposed Maximum 
Concentration
Actual Concentration
Lead (Pb)
0.1%
< 0.1%
Mercury (Hg)
0.1%
< 0.1%
Cadmium (Cd)
0.01%
< 0.01%
Hexavalent Chromium (Cr
6+
)
0.1%
< 0.1%
Polybrominated biphenyls (PBB)
0.1%
< 0.1%
Polybrominated diphenyl ethers (PBDE)
0.1%
< 0.1%
Certain components of products as stated above are exempted under the Annex of 
the RoHS Directives as noted below:
Examples of exempted components are:
1.  Mercury in compact fluorescent lamps not exceeding 5 mg per lamp and in other 
lamps not specifically mentioned in the Annex of RoHS Directive.
2.  Lead in glass of cathode ray tubes, electronic components, fluorescent tubes, 
and electronic ceramic parts (e.g. piezoelectronic devices).
3.  Lead in high temperature type solders (i.e. lead-based alloys containing 85% by 
weight or more lead).
4.  Lead as an allotting element in steel containing up to 0.35% lead by weight, 
aluminum containing up to 0.4% lead by weight and as a cooper alloy containing 
up to 4% lead by weight.
